Pricing Analysis
Price comparison per million tokens
For input processing, GPT-4o ($2.50/1M tokens) is 41.7x more expensive than Ling 3.0 Flash Fin ($0.06/1M tokens).
For output processing, GPT-4o ($10.00/1M tokens) is 55.6x more expensive than Ling 3.0 Flash Fin ($0.18/1M tokens).
In conclusion, GPT-4o is more expensive than Ling 3.0 Flash Fin.*
* Using a 3:1 ratio of input to output tokens
Context Window
Maximum input and output token capacity
Ling 3.0 Flash Fin accepts 262,144 input tokens compared to GPT-4o's 128,000 tokens. Ling 3.0 Flash Fin can generate longer responses up to 262,144 tokens, while GPT-4o is limited to 16,384 tokens.

Release Timeline
When each model was launched
GPT-4o was released on 2024-08-06, while Ling 3.0 Flash Fin was released on 2026-09-03.
Ling 3.0 Flash Fin is 25 months newer than GPT-4o.
